Sort of a spin-off of that suspected troll thread... I actually have a recipe for making a near carbon copy of Gatorade Endurance formula, which has about twice the electrolytes of the regular stuff, but is $$, hard to find, and comes in only limited flavors.
Faux Endurance Sportsdrink
1/2 C. + 4 tsp. sugar
1/2 tsp. Morton Lite Salt
1/2 tsp. table salt
1 pkg. unsweetened "Kool-aid" mix (any flavor you like)
Mix with 2 Q. water to make 64 oz.
Each 8 oz serving has 56 Calories, 14 grams carbohydrate, 220 mg sodium and 85 mg potassium.
Gatorade Endurance Formula (8 oz) has 50 Calories, 14 grams carbohydrate, 200 mg sodium, and 90 mg potassium.
I have been known to make this with powered Splenda or that Splenda/sugar blend--when I don't want all the calories, but still want the electrolytes.
